Family Name: The surname 杨 originates from the Zhou Dynasty, tracing back to Bo Qiao, a grandson of King Wu of Zhou. Bo Qiao was granted the fief of Yang (present-day Hongdong, Shanxi), and his descendants adopted the surname 杨. The name 杨 refers to the poplar tree, symbolizing strength and resilience. Prominent branches of the Yang family include the弘农杨氏 and 天水杨氏, with notable historical figures such as Yang Zhen, Emperor Yang of Sui, and Yang Yuhuan.
